Colonials Earn Seven Gold Finishes at Bowling Green

Bowling Green, Ohio - February 1, 2010 - This past weekend the Robert Morris University men's track and field team competed in the Tom Wright Classic and earned a total of seven first-place finishes. Junior T.J. Green (Stamford, Conn. / Milford Academy) led the Colonials with two gold medals.

Green earned his first top finish in the 60-meter dash, crossing the finish line in a time of 7.04. He earned his second first-place finish in the 200-meter dash with a time of 22.62.

Anthony Thornton (Torrington, Conn. / Torrington) placed first in the 600-meter run with a time of 1:27.52, while teammate Tyler Morton (Silver Spring, Md. / Springbrook) earned the third spot, clocking in at 1:28.70. Freshman Michael Robinson (Reynoldsville, Pa. / Dubois) placed first in the 800-meter run with a time of 1:57.29, while rookie Ben Ingle earned a top finish in the one-mile run, crossing the finish line in a time of 4:29.66. Sophomore Arthur Leathers (Taneytown, Md. / Francis Scott Key) also performed well in the distance events and took first in the 5000-meter run with a time of 15:40.14. The men's distance medley team earned a season-best finish with a time of 10:51.24.

Chris Spataro (Gibsonia, Pa. / Pine Richland) represented the Colonials in the pole vault and earned a first-place finish with a season-best leap of 4.40 meters. Lance Washington (East Stroudsburg, Pa. / Stroudsburg) took second in both the long jump and the triple jump, with marks of 5.75 meters and 13.10 meters, respectively. Brendan Morales (Westminster, Md. / Westminster) placed well in the shot put with a second-place finish and a mark of 15.05 meters.

The Colonials return to action this Friday, February 5 to compete in the Marietta Open Alumni Meet.
